Product Portfolio of Paydar Behbood Machine Manufacturing: A Broad Spectrum of Expertise
The diversity of Paydar Behbood Machine’s product portfolio reflects the wide scope of the company’s activities within the medical equipment and polymer industries. This portfolio has been designed to address the varied needs of manufacturers, ranging from small laboratory-scale units to large industrial production facilities.
- Cleanroom Sector
Paydar Behbood Machine is active in the design and implementation of cleanrooms related to medical equipment manufacturing. As one of the fundamental and critical infrastructural pillars of advanced production lines, this area is developed with strict adherence to the requirements of various ISO cleanroom classes (such as ISO 14644) and with careful attention to relevant technical and regulatory standards.
- Standard Tube Extruders
This category includes a complete range of extruders for the production of standard plastic tubes, manufactured in various capacities:
- 5 kg extruder (for prototyping and limited production)
- 10 kg extruder
- 20 kg extruder
- 30 kg extruder
- 40 kg extruder
- 50 kg extruder (for mass production)
Each of these models is designed in response to specific market needs and is equipped with precise adjustment capabilities for key parameters such as temperature, pressure, and production speed.
- Specialized Medical Tube Extruders
Given the sensitivity and strict regulatory standards of medical products, this segment includes specialized machinery such as:
- Multilayer tube extruders (for advanced pharmaceutical applications)
- Dental tube extruders
- Custom-designed extruders for tubes with specific specifications (tailored to customer requirements)
- Vacuum-assisted extruders (for bubble elimination and enhanced product quality)
- Laboratory and Specialized Equipment
- Laboratory extruders: Designed for research, development, and testing of new formulations prior to mass production
- Barium sulfate extruders: Specifically developed for the production of contrast (radiopaque) products used in the medical industry
- Tip Forming Machines
These machines are designed for shaping tube nozzles and include the following models:
- Single-channel manual tip forming machines (for small workshops)
- Dual-channel manual tip forming machines
- Dual-channel semi-automatic tip forming machines (for increased productivity)
- Four-channel semi-automatic tip forming machines (for medium and large production lines)
Other Products
To complete the production cycle, Paydar Behbood Machine also offers a range of additional equipment, including:
- Nelaton punching machine
- Medical-grade PVC granulator
- Polymeric medical dispenser
- Precision quality control gauge box for diameters from 1 to 10 mm
- Precision quality control gauge box for diameters from 10 to 13 mm
- Medical tube leak testing machine (to ensure the integrity of the final product)
- Medical industrial chiller 4000
- Industrial chiller 24000

Manufacturing Specialized Plastic Injection Molds: Precision in the Service of Medicine
In the medical industry, mold making is considered one of the most sensitive stages of production. High precision at the micron level, repeatability across thousands of production cycles, and strict adherence to quality requirements have made this field one of the most specialized branches of the plastics industry. Even a minor error in mold design or manufacturing can lead to mass production of defective products, resulting in significant financial and reputational losses.

Production Line Installation and Implementation: From Deployment to Stability
The installation and implementation of a production line is one of the most critical stages in establishing medical equipment manufacturing facilities. This phase is not limited to the physical placement of machinery; rather, it involves precise coordination among machines, energy infrastructures (electricity, water, compressed air), ventilation and temperature control systems, cleanroom deployment, workforce training, and the integration of operational processes. Even a minor error in installation or initial setup can lead to months of reduced productivity, increased waste, and the production of non-compliant products.
Paydar Behbood Machine plays an active and responsible role in this stage. The process of production line installation and implementation is carried out step by step and based on precise planning—from the placement of machinery and their accurate leveling, to the initial adjustment of production parameters, preliminary testing with real materials, training of operators and line supervisors, and ultimately accompanying the client until stable, high-quality production is achieved.
